Property Details for 403/28 West St, North Sydney

403/28 West St, North Sydney is a 2 bedroom, 2 bathroom Unit with 1 parking spaces and was built in 2000. The property has a land size of 4464m2 and floor size of 84m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in December 2017.

About North Sydney 2060

The size of North Sydney is approximately 1.5 square kilometres. There are 21 parks, covering nearly 7.7% of the total area. The population of North Sydney in 2016 was 7705 people. By 2021 the population was 8964 showing a population growth of 16.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in North Sydney is 30-39 years. Households in North Sydney are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in North Sydney work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 36.30% of the homes in North Sydney were owner-occupied compared with 37.80% in 2016.

North Sydney has 8,175 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in North Sydney have seen a -15.15% decrease in median value, while Units have seen a -5.66% decrease. As at 31 August 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in North Sydney is $2,788,593 while the median value for Units is $1,204,614.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,285 while Units have a median rent of $830.
